Tenenbaum Law Group PLLC is a nationally recognized, boutique Washington, DC-based law firm specializing in the representation of nonprofit organizations and related entities across the United States. Serving primarily as outside general counsel, the firm advises senior management and boards of directors of charities, trade and professional associations, international NGOs, arts and cultural institutions, foundations, and other nonprofits – as well as companies and executives that work with or provide services to nonprofits – on the broad array of legal issues and challenges they face. The firm brings decades of Big Law experience to bear with small firm cost-efficiency, responsiveness, and turnaround time. With a focus on workable, impactful solutions, spirited defense and advocacy, a practical understanding of the broader nonprofit context and best practices, and attorneys who take their work – but not themselves – very seriously, TLG prides itself on partnering with its clients in a strategic manner to help ensure maximum effectiveness and results, all while exercising great judgment.

Managing Partner Jeff Tenenbaum is widely recognized as one of the nation’s most accomplished nonprofit legal practitioners, a top leader in the nonprofit bar, a frequent media commentator and expert witness on nonprofit legal issues, and a distinguished thought leader and active participant in the nonprofit legal community. Counsel Nisha Thakker has spent most of her 15-year legal career in-house in the nonprofit legal world, bringing a unique, invaluable perspective to the practice. Counsel Julie Kulovits spent six years as in-house general counsel of a North American professional medical association and prior to that was a commercial litigator in private practice for ten years. Both Nisha and Julie also are very active in the nonprofit legal community.

Honors and Recognition

While awards and honors don’t make great lawyers, over 15 years of annual recognition from all of the leading bestowers of such awards and honors is acknowledgment in which our attorneys take humble gratification. TLG is very proud to have been awarded – in its first year of existence – the (top) Tier 1 designation in the Washington, DC metropolitan area for Nonprofit/Charities Law for 2021 by Best Law Firms/U.S. News & World Report®, and then again for 2022. The firm is one of only six law firms in the region to have been granted this distinguished Tier 1 honor in 2021 and 2022, and the only boutique firm among the six. TLG’s Managing Partner Jeff Tenenbaum is one of only six attorneys in the prestigious U.S. Legal 500’s Not-for-Profit Hall of Fame, is listed in the 2012-22 editions of The Best Lawyers in America® for Nonprofit/Charities Law nationally, and was selected for inclusion in the 2014-21 editions of Washington, DC Super Lawyers in the Nonprofit Organizations category.
